After reporting another record fiscal year of volume growth, the Port of Savannah’s near-term encore is likely to be somewhat muted.
The nation’s fourth-busiest container port broke the 5 million twenty-foot equivalent unit barrier in its 2021 fiscal year, according to a data published Monday by the Georgia Ports Authority, the state agency that runs the container port, the Port of Brunswick, a bulk, breakbulk and roll-on, roll-off facility for vehicles, and an inland port facility in...
